The North America 3D Automated Optical Inspection (AOI) equipment market has been expanding significantly, driven by the increasing adoption of advanced inspection technologies in various industrial sectors. AOI systems play a critical role in inspecting the surface quality and integrity of various products, making them essential in ensuring high-quality manufacturing processes. The demand for 3D AOI equipment, in particular, has been growing, as it enables more detailed and precise inspection compared to traditional 2D systems. The market is segmented by application into PCB (Printed Circuit Board), FPD (Flat Panel Display, including LCD, OLED, and other display technologies), semiconductor, and other industries. Each of these segments is experiencing unique growth dynamics based on the specific requirements and technological advancements in their respective fields.
The PCB segment is one of the largest applications for 3D AOI equipment, as these systems are crucial for inspecting the intricate and highly detailed components of printed circuit boards. With the rapid evolution of electronics and an increasing need for miniaturization, the demand for reliable inspection tools has surged. 3D AOI equipment offers enhanced inspection capabilities by providing detailed 3D representations of PCB assemblies, identifying defects such as misalignments, soldering defects, and component orientation issues. This technology ensures higher levels of accuracy and precision in detecting defects that may not be easily visible with traditional 2D systems. Moreover, the increasing complexity of PCB designs due to trends like IoT (Internet of Things), wearable electronics, and automotive electronics is further boosting the adoption of 3D AOI in PCB manufacturing.
The demand for 3D AOI equipment in the PCB segment is also fueled by the growing need for mass production of high-quality, defect-free PCBs, particularly in industries such as consumer electronics, automotive, and telecommunications. As these industries continue to advance and diversify, the ability to achieve high-quality assurance in PCB production is more critical than ever. 3D AOI equipment plays a significant role in improving yield rates, reducing production downtime, and ensuring product reliability, making it a key asset in PCB production lines. Additionally, the trend toward automation in PCB manufacturing has driven the growth of AOI equipment, as manufacturers strive to increase throughput while maintaining stringent quality standards.
The Flat Panel Display (FPD) segment, which includes technologies like LCD, OLED, and other advanced display types, is another important application for 3D AOI equipment. The increasing adoption of high-definition displays in consumer electronics, automotive displays, and other applications is propelling the demand for precise inspection tools. FPDs are highly sensitive components, and the quality of these displays is critical for end-user experience, making thorough inspection an essential part of the manufacturing process. 3D AOI systems are particularly useful in inspecting the fine details of FPDs, such as pixel density, alignment, and backlight uniformity, which require high-resolution and precise 3D measurements to ensure optimal performance.
The growth of the FPD segment is driven by the rapid advancements in display technology, particularly the shift toward OLED displays, which are known for their superior image quality and flexibility. As manufacturers continue to innovate in display technologies, the complexity of the manufacturing process increases, necessitating advanced inspection systems like 3D AOI to detect even the smallest defects that can affect the display's performance. Additionally, as display applications expand into industries such as automotive and healthcare, the demand for high-precision inspection solutions will continue to rise. 3D AOI equipment helps manufacturers maintain product quality and meet the stringent standards required for these advanced display technologies, supporting the broader growth of the FPD market.
The semiconductor industry has long been a key driver of technological innovation, and the integration of 3D AOI equipment into semiconductor manufacturing processes is playing a pivotal role in maintaining high-quality standards. Semiconductors are the backbone of modern electronics, and the intricate manufacturing process requires precise inspection to detect minute defects that could lead to malfunctions or performance issues. 3D AOI systems are employed in semiconductor production to inspect wafer-level packaging, soldering quality, and assembly integrity. These systems provide accurate 3D imaging and measurements to detect defects such as misalignment, shorts, or voids, which are difficult to identify with traditional inspection methods.
As the semiconductor industry continues to scale up production to meet the demands of emerging technologies like 5G, artificial intelligence, and autonomous vehicles, the need for advanced inspection systems has become even more pronounced. The high-volume and high-precision nature of semiconductor manufacturing makes 3D AOI equipment an invaluable tool in ensuring that each chip is defect-free and operates as intended. Furthermore, the increasing miniaturization of semiconductor components requires inspection solutions that can handle increasingly complex geometries. The semiconductor segment's growth in the North American 3D AOI market is expected to remain robust, driven by technological advancements, rising production volumes, and the increasing complexity of semiconductor devices.

1. What is 3D AOI technology used for?
3D AOI technology is used for inspecting the surface quality and structural integrity of components in manufacturing, providing detailed 3D imaging to identify defects in products such as PCBs, semiconductors, and displays.
2. How does 3D AOI differ from traditional 2D AOI?
3D AOI offers higher accuracy by providing detailed depth information, allowing for the detection of defects that may not be visible with 2D inspection methods, making it ideal for complex and miniaturized components.
3. What industries use 3D AOI equipment?
3D AOI equipment is used in industries such as PCB manufacturing, semiconductors, flat panel displays, automotive, aerospace, and medical devices, where precision and quality control are critical.
4. Why is 3D AOI important for the semiconductor industry?
In semiconductor manufacturing, 3D AOI helps detect defects such as misalignments and voids, ensuring that chips function properly, especially as components become smaller and more complex.
5. What are the key benefits of 3D AOI in PCB manufacturing?
In PCB manufacturing, 3D AOI enhances defect detection, improves yield rates, and ensures higher quality assurance in mass production, helping manufacturers meet the demand for high-performance electronic products.
